process(size_t framesToProcess)52 void RealtimeAnalyserNode::process(size_t framesToProcess)
53 {
54     AudioBus* outputBus = output(0)->bus();
55 
56     if (!isInitialized() || !input(0)->isConnected()) {
57         outputBus->zero();
58         return;
59     }
60 
61     AudioBus* inputBus = input(0)->bus();
62 
63     // Give the analyser the audio which is passing through this AudioNode.
64     m_analyser.writeInput(inputBus, framesToProcess);
65 
66     // For in-place processing, our override of pullInputs() will just pass the audio data through unchanged if the channel count matches from input to output
67     // (resulting in inputBus == outputBus).  Otherwise, do an up-mix to stereo.
68     if (inputBus != outputBus)
69         outputBus->copyFrom(*inputBus);
70 }
71 
72 // We override pullInputs() as an optimization allowing this node to take advantage of in-place processing,
73 // where the input is simply passed through unprocessed to the output.
74 // Note: this only applies if the input and output channel counts match.
pullInputs(size_t framesToProcess)75 void RealtimeAnalyserNode::pullInputs(size_t framesToProcess)
76 {
77     // Render input stream - try to render directly into output bus for pass-through processing where process() doesn't need to do anything...
78     input(0)->pull(output(0)->bus(), framesToProcess);
79 }
